    @DTreserve said in Address bar height and empty space: P.S. Is 32px the thinnest? The rule for 32px is to make sure the window control buttons don't overflow the container element. Actually it would be better to make the buttons inherit the height from the parent.: height: inherit !important;` And then set the height value of the .toolbar-mainbar instead. Once you start going below 30px it will cause the url field to overflow instead. And other elements will start to look bad. And going even thinner will lead to having to force a font-size change in the url field etc etc. You can go how deep you want down the rabbit hole and tear your hair out over it as much you like

    @AllanH said in VIVALDI STANDALONE BROKEN after the latest update: I have always located the Stable in \AppData\Local, but Vivaldi would not start for me. I had always used the "Run this program as an Administrator" option in the file properties, but after I disabled that option, Vivaldi did start. There is no need to change Vivaldi app property to elevate user rights. Vivaldi runs if you use Installer's Advanced → Install For the User.
